Saved Search : Concat all item description on a Sales order to a single line

I have a saved search that we want to be a single line, but pull in line level / item details. I have already summed the item weights and other item attributes, but we require the unique item descriptions for all the items on the sales order. Does anyone have guidance on how to reflect a string/text of unique, multiple, item descriptions into one column keeping the order at a single line in the saved search

Ex:

If order, SO123, had item 1, item 2, and item 3 on it and they all had unique descriptions on their item page, how do I bring all descriptions into 1 line . I put example attachment because Im struggling to explain.
